Transaction 34ba90f6b775257ac9c58ca9b28e4cbd2590a7b77d3e2659240074ce1e7aef11
1 Input
1 Output
-
34ba90f6b775257ac9c58ca9b28e4cbd2590a7b77d3e2659240074ce1e7aef11:0
- value
- 403256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62c7f362965c8ef71242696ec446660d28f28f6f OP_EQUAL
- address
- 3AhKgAQMZdxyc6XFyDkeXCGBxhFpDbpQuv